I'm not being clear enough, sorry.

In the case of PSG data, this is always just a single byte.

In the .VGM file, this single byte is logged as "0x50 dd" where dd is the data nibbles used for the PSG byte for that entry.

What the Max patch does - and of course it sounds simple NOW but it took me half the morning tongue - is extract those single byte entries, and time them based on the delta timing entries.

This stream of single bytes is encoded as MIDI data - specifically of the form:
MIDI Control Message:
controller value = PSG data & B01111111;
controller number = PSG Data & B10000000 >>1;
channel = B00010000;

This leaves room for YM2612 OR YM2413 data in the form of:
controller value = YM data & B01111111;
controller number = YM address & B01111111;
channel = ((YM address & B10000000) >> 5) | ((YM data & B10000000) >> 6) |  page);
